12/27/2005 Posted by joecusanelli
My wife and I stayed at the Shoreham for a NYC weekend getaway. The hotel was small and older, but was nice. We were upgraded to a newly renovated luxury suite. The room was large by NYC standards, with a seating area and a sleeping area, but there was no view. The room was equipped with two plasma TVs, but they were only hooked up to antenna service and the reception was poor. But we did not pay $500/night to watch TV anyway. The hotel had a very cool shower with 5 showerheads squirting from all directions and a tub/spa. The shampoo was Aveda brand, which I never heard of, but my wife was impressed. But the best thing was the complimentary cappuccino bar.
Pros: complimentary cappucc, the 5 headed shower, plasma TV
Cons: no view, no parking

08/19/2003 Posted by salky
I wanted to write this to let everyone know how much I, and others appreciated the kindness from the entire Shoreham staff. I was booked already in the hotel and checked out the day of the blackout. When the airports were closed for obvious reasons. I headed back to the only place I knew, the Shoreham. They had my original room for me along with many others that seemed to have done exactly what I did. A personal escort was conducted along with giving out candles so that the guests were not without light. I even witnessed the the hotel employees setting up food for the guests complimentary. I have to say that while faced with a disaster, The Shoreham really pulled through. Each time I come to New York this is always the hotel I choose, and this will continue to be the hotel of choice.
